ON April 10, 1912, the Titanic started her first trip from Southampton, England, to New York City, US.The ship was the world's largest and most luxurious(豪华的)one at that time.
High-class facilities(设备)for passengers including restaurants, a library and a swimming pool made the ship like a floating hotel.More importantly, its owners and builders said it was unsinkable(不会下沉的).
However, on April 15, the ship sank to the bottom of the Atlantic Ocean and killed over 1,500 people.
This April 15, on the 100th anniversary(周年纪念)of the sinking of the Titanic, people in the UK and US will hold activities to remember the event.James Cameron's 1997 film, Titanic, was a huge hit all around the world.Now the 3-D film will come to Chinese theaters on April 10.It is a love story between a poor young man named Jack and a rich young woman named Rose on the unlucky ship.In Belfast, UK, the port of the Titanic's birth, a museum called Titanic Belfast will open to the public.
Today, the sinking of the Titanic is not just an accident.It has become a popular expression to mean a large disaster or mistake, usually because of too much confidence.
In the UK, if somebody says that his or her mobile phone is really great and could never break, others might say, “Yeah, and people said the Titanic was unsinkable.” In other words, no matter how confident or proud people are about something, anything can go wrong.

Jack is a twenty-year-old young man.Two years ago, when he finished middle school, he found work in a shop.Usually he works until ten o’clock in the evening.He is very tired when he gets home.After a quick supper he goes to bed and soon falls asleep.His grandma who lives downstairs is pleased with him.
One day, on his way home, he met his friend Mary.They were both happy.He asked the girl to his house, and she agreed happily.He bought some fruit and drinks for her.And they talked about their school, teachers, classmates and their future.They talked for a long time.
“Have a look at your watch, please,”said the girl.“What time is it now?”
“Sorry, something is wrong with my watch,”said Jack.“Where’s yours?”
“I left it at home.”
Jack thought for a moment and found a way.He began to stamp his foot on the floor, “Bang! Bang! Bang!”
The sound woke his grandma up.The old woman shouted downstairs, “It’s twelve o’clock in the night, Jack.Why are you still jumping upstairs?”
